Essays from the Edge of Science is author and researcher Kenneth W. Behrendt's latest contribution to the literature of the New Age. It is an exciting and insightful analysis of various topics that takes the reader from the depths of our planet's oceans to the farthest reaches of cosmic space and time while outlining what will most likely be accepted science by the end of this century. You'll learn about the astonishing telepathic powers of the so-called lower animals. An entire chapter is devoted to the living subterrestrial creatures that inhabit the Earth's crust and whose highly evolved paranormal powers are responsible for many of the events taking place in haunted houses. The soon coming elimination of fossil fuels and their replacement by free energy devices that use the power of permanent magnets is discussed. Even the nature of time as well as a means to "travel" through it is explored as the reader is taken on an imaginary ride aboard what could be the first truly functional time machine. In a highly controversial chapter, the author finally gives the real reason that our planet's major governments dare not reveal what they know about the UFO phenomenon! All this, however, is only a small sample of what awaits one in this incredible work. This book is sure to fascinate the general reader who has always suspected that what we have been taught is real is, in fact, only a very small portion of a much larger and stranger reality. Now that rarely seen hidden reality is exposed so that it can finally be a subject for serious scientific inquiry.

Kenneth W. Behrendt has been a lifelong student of phenomena in the fields of ufology and the paranormal. Although professionally trained as a chemist, he has been investigating and writing about the UFO phenomenon since the early 1980s. He has had several personal sightings of UFOs during his lifetime that have convinced him in the reality of these objects and considers their study to be of great importance to humanity. He currently resides in suburban New Jersey, where he continues his researches in the areas of ufology, paranormal phenomena, and free energy physics.
